Weymouth frustrated by Bishop’s Stortford leveller

WEYMOUTH 1

Brooks 59

BISHOP’S STORTFORD 1

Foxley 73

A CALVIN Brooks goal was cancelled out by Mark Hughes as Weymouth had to settle for a point in a 1-1 draw with a stern Bishop’s Stortford side at the Bob Lucas Stadium in the Evo-Stik Southern Premier Division.

Brooks put Weymouth ahead in the 59th minute from a Ben Thomson cross, but Blues’ captain Hughes hit back to level the scores in the 73rd minute as Weymouth remained in third place in the standings.

Goalkeeper Will Dennis made his debut for Weymouth in their only change after his signing was announced on Thursday with Mark Travers having been recalled by Bournemouth.

 

Prior to the match the Terras also announced that Jordan Ngalo had signed a contract with the club after impressing with substitute appearances against Redditch and Gosport.

 

Jake McCarthy made his first appearance in the Terras’ matchday squad since November after suffering from appendicitis.

For the Blues, veteran striker Jamie Cureton started having been signed prior to their 3-0 loss to Royston Town on New Year’s Day.

The two sides exchanged early attacks with Terras’ captain Callum Buckley having to clear under pressure from Jack Thomas.

Shortly after, Brandon Goodship worked well with Brooks who found Thomson in the box but the ball ran out for a goal-kick.

Charlie Davis then tried an ambitious effort from the halfway line as he attempted to catch Blues’ goalkeeper Tyler McCarthy off his line, and his shot beat the keeper only to fall narrowly wide.

Weymouth started brightly as Thomson got into the box but before he could fire a shot in he was tackled by Joe Robinson.

Dennis had a nervy moment soon after, dropping the ball with Jason Williams lurking, but Buckley was quick to get the ball away from danger.

Wakefield came close to scoring with an awkward shot that was heading for the bottom corner but McCarthy prevented any danger.

Davis nearly scored as his shot was blocked on the line after a Wakefield cross, while Goodship’s follow-up was blocked in the 28th minute.

 

Thomson then went on the attack with a long winding run in the 36th minute but his shot from 10 yards out went wide of the left-hand post.

Thomson and Wakefield duly worked well together but the shot from a tight angle from the latter was saved by McCarthy as the first half wound to a close.

Mark Molesley’s men started the second half on the attack as a great run down the right-hand side saw Thomson one-on-one with keeper McCarthy, who was fast off his line to clear the ball away.

Thomson had another great chance early on as he curled a shot over from 15 yards out from a Wakefield cross.

Afolabi Akinyemi worked his way into the Weymouth box for the Blues but his shot went over from a similar distance.

The Blues then built another good attack as Foxley got down the left-hand side again and crossed towards Williams only for Weymouth to clear away.

Moments later the Terras got the breakthrough as a cross from Thomson was headed against the post by Brooks, before he right wing-back managed to tuck the rebound in past McCarthy.

Soon after Goodship had two chances in quick succession, Davis fed the striker and he fired a deflected shot wide before shooting wide from outside the box.

But a spell of pressure from the Blues saw them equalise as a Foxley corner created a scramble in the box, allowing Hughes to tuck home.

Shortly after Buckley slid into block a shot from Cureton to keep the Terras on terms.

 

After Westcott brought down Thomson a yard outside the box, for which he was booked, Goodship curled the free-kick round the wall prompting McCarthy into a superb save.

The away side went down to 10 men late on after Hughes was sent off for two yellow cards in quick succession for late tackles.

But Weymouth could not find the winner on a frustrating afternoon at the Bob Lucas Stadium.
